A luxury jewelry design company is seeking a talented Jewelry Designer to create unique, fine jewelry pieces. Responsibilities include designing collections, managing the customer experience, and overseeing the production process.
The ideal candidate must have formal qualifications, excellent communication skills, and proficiency in design software, along with a basic understanding of gemology.
This position offers the opportunity to engage with clients and attend to custom requests, providing an exceptional service experience.
